Marinated Grilled Chicken Recipe - Cooking Index
1/2 cup | 118ml | Lemon juice |
1/4 | Olive oil | |
1/2 teaspoon | 2.5ml | Salt |
1/2 teaspoon | 2.5ml | Freshly-ground black pepper |
1 tablespoon | 15ml | Fresh oregano |
= (or 1/4 tspn dried oregano) | ||
2 | Chickens - quartered |
Make marinade by combining lemon juice, olive oil, salt, pepper, and oregano. Place chicken in a dish with tall sides and pour marinade over chicken. Use spoon to baste chicken with marinade. Refrigerate for 2 to 24 hours -- a longer marinade time will produce a more intense flavor.
Remove from refrigerator and use a flat-sided utensil to gently scrape off any marinade solids. Grill chicken over high heat for a total of 20 minutes, turning over after first 10 minutes. Season with salt and pepper.
This recipe yields 8 servings.
